Transaction 48b0339d107c147928ef14dff709795fd6887828bf17aaae86765b80467d3841

2 Input
2 Outputs
  • 48b0339d107c147928ef14dff709795fd6887828bf17aaae86765b80467d3841:0
  • value  142414
    address  3HNhDy4ecWVbVam5wfJmg1ZzJCc69zpeWw
  • 48b0339d107c147928ef14dff709795fd6887828bf17aaae86765b80467d3841:1
  • value  155000000
    address  15ieAPdrZsfGCpPtwr6EshbpFuNydidijm